Output 41efdb24b20e60d62325f9468838137330e900469e80c918b02efdf5690f7696:1

value
1688692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 902f43a3cf7119df643d32256d8bd0977ac5c2ce OP_EQUAL
address
3EqPr9EcNuis3VchGQ8d3jvn5vT1SeXEeS
transaction
41efdb24b20e60d62325f9468838137330e900469e80c918b02efdf5690f7696
spent
true